Prepare master for new framework integration
[AGL/meta-agl-demo.git] / recipes-platform / images / agl-image-ivi-crosssdk.bb
index 93537fe..9636b60 100644 (file)
@@ -1,2 +1,20 @@
-# just for backward compatibility
-require recipes-platform/images/agl-image-minimal-crosssdk.bb
+require recipes-platform/images/agl-image-minimal-crosssdk.inc
+
+require recipes-platform/images/agl-image-minimal.inc
+
+IMAGE_INSTALL:append = "\
+    packagegroup-agl-image-ivi \
+    packagegroup-agl-ivi-services \
+    ${@bb.utils.contains('DISTRO_FEATURES', 'pipewire', 'packagegroup-pipewire', '', d)} \
+    can-utils \
+    iproute2 \
+    "
+
+IMAGE_FEATURES += "splash package-management ssh-server-dropbear"
+
+inherit populate_sdk
+
+# Task do_populate_sdk and do_rootfs can't be exec simultaneously.
+# Both exec "createrepo" on the same directory, and so one of them
+# can failed (randomly).
+addtask do_populate_sdk after do_rootfs